

Google Workspace and Google Cloud Storage compete in the cloud services category. Google Workspace has the upper hand due to its comprehensive collaboration tools and ease of integration.
Features: Google Workspace integrates powerful collaboration tools like Gmail, Drive, and Meet seamlessly across devices, making it ideal for teamwork. It offers Google Docs and Drive with revision tracking and integration with other platforms. Google Cloud Storage specializes in flexible storage solutions, robust security measures, and reliable data access from multiple devices.
Room for Improvement: Google Workspace needs better integration with Outlook, enhanced email UI, and improved conversion between Google and Microsoft platforms. Google Cloud Storage requires improvements in storage space allocation, user interface integration, and enhanced security features. Users request more free storage and better synchronization with other platforms.
Ease of Deployment and Customer Service: Both Google Workspace and Google Cloud Storage use public cloud deployments, but Cloud Storage also offers private cloud options. Google Workspace has mixed customer service experiences, with good online resources but less direct support. Cloud Storage is praised for cost-effectiveness but could improve direct technical support accessibility.
Pricing and ROI: Google Workspace is affordable for non-profits and education but may be costly for small businesses. It offers good ROI through productivity and collaboration. Google Cloud Storage has a competitive pricing model with free initial storage, flexible pay-as-you-go options, and scalable pricing that effectively manages expenses.

Similar to G Suite, all Google Workspace plans provide a custom email for your business and include collaboration tools like Gmail, Calendar, Meet, Chat, Drive, Docs, Sheets, Slides, Forms, Sites, and more.
As we’ve evolved G Suite into a more integrated experience across our communication and collaboration tools, we’ve rebranded to Google Workspace to more accurately represent the product vision.
